Discriminant is the expression under the radical in a quadratic equation formula that indicates the nature of the solutions real or complex, rational or irrational , single or double root in other words
A discriminant can be said to be used to indicate the nature of the result that a quadratic equation when solved will yield and this can be : rational or irrational , complex or real, single or double roots. and it also indicates by how many it would be
